Ayurvedic Treatment For Hair Loss – Massaging

Though, in previous articles we covered everything from “reason of hair loss” to various “hair loss treatment”. Continuing the discussion; today’s article is “massaging as hair loss treatment. So let’s see how massage could help in regaining the lost hairs.

Regular oiling and massage on the scalp with oil enhances blood circulation on the scalp. Daily massage your scalp with amala (Biological Name: Emblica officinalis) (Other Local Name: Indian Gooseberry, Emblic myrobalan, Amla, Amalaki ) oil for 5 to 10 minutes to stimulate the circulation. Amalas are known to be rich source of vitamin E that greatly prevent & slows down the hair fall. People suffering acute hair fall, reported improvement in the condition.

Coconut and almond oil have also been in great demand as hair oil. Massage them on the scalp and soles of the feet every alternate day before bed.

Boil the lemon leaves in water, cool it and rinse your hair with it.

There are lots of herbal serums available in the market. One could use them as substitute of oil. For first few weeks you may need to apply regularly & gradually coming down to few times in a week. Massage serum just like any other hair oil for five to 10 minutes with slack fingers; leave it on for a night and rinse wash following morning.

After rinsing your hair, don’t forget to apply good conditioner on the scalp. The herbal serum nourishes hair follicles’ and soothes itchiness. I believe, very soon you will surely see some decent results.

You can also try the combination of Indian oils such as as brahmi, shikakai and reetha. Bramhi, shikakai and reetha are proven remedies for nourishment of hair and scalp.
